Denim fabric: a true emblem

The timeless and iconic denim fabric has spanned the ages with constant, even growing, popularity. From its humble beginnings in the 19th century to its status as a must-have piece of contemporary fashion, denim has found its way into hearts and wardrobes around the world!

Denim fabric is particularly distinguished by its characteristic diagonal lines, which create a pattern that is recognizable among thousands. Its "core" dyed fibers guarantee a deep and uniform color that stands the test of time. This is what distinguishes it from denim fabric. And yes, you may not have known it, but denim fabric has weft (ecru) and warp (usually indigo) threads of different colors. This is what will give it this very particular washed look over time!

Denim fabric’s legendary durability makes it a great choice for designers looking for durable garments, while its versatility makes it affordable for any budget. When used to make jeans, it becomes a super cost-effective sewing project because it can be worn every day, all year long!

But the one creation that immediately comes to mind when we talk about denim is of course… jeans, yes! Let’s see what types of jeans you can create:

1. Slim jeans:

Slim jeans are characterized by their fitted cut that hugs the body's shape. Perfect for an elegant and modern look, they highlight the silhouette and remain super comfortable.

2. Boyfriend jeans:

Boyfriend jeans stand out for their loose and relaxed cut, inspired by the masculine wardrobe. They are ideal for a casual and urban style, they bring a touch of nonchalance to your outfits.

3. Flared jeans:

Flare jeans feature a fitted cut through the hips and thighs, then gradually flare out from the knee. A symbol of the 70s, they add a retro and bohemian touch to your wardrobe.

4. Bootcut jeans:

Bootcut jeans are recognizable by their slim fit at the hips and thighs, then slightly flared from the knee, allowing you to wear boots or heels. They are literally suitable for any occasion.

Our tips for sewing well with denim fabric

Have you decided to start sewing with denim fabric? Great idea! To successfully complete your project without any difficulty, it is essential to have the right equipment. Here are our recommendations to help you sew denim easily.

1. Choose the right tools:

When sewing denim, it is essential to use the right needle. It is a good idea to go for a denim needle, also known as a universal needle or denim needle. These needles are designed to pierce thick fabrics like denim without breaking. They come in different sizes, so choose one based on the thickness of your fabric.

When it comes to thread, stick to a quality, durable thread like polyester or cotton-polyester thread. These types of thread are stronger and better suited for sewing thick fabrics like denim. Also, make sure to have an extra spool of thread on hand, as sewing jeans can use up more thread than you expect!

2. Prepare your sewing machine:

Before you start sewing your denim fabric, make sure your sewing machine is set up correctly. Adjust the thread tension and stitch length according to the thickness of the denim you are using. For the main seams, go for a sturdy straight stitch, while for the finishing touches, you can use a zigzag stitch for more flexibility.

Also, consider installing a special denim presser foot if your machine allows it. This presser foot has a non-stick sole that makes it easier to pass the fabric under the needle.

3. Adopt good sewing techniques:

When sewing denim, use pins or clips to hold the pieces in place, as the fabric can be difficult to handle due to its thickness. Avoid pulling or forcing the fabric under the needle, as this can cause the needle to break or damage your sewing machine.

For hems and finishes, remember to topstitch the seams to prevent them from fraying. You can also reinforce stress areas, such as pockets or hems, by sewing several times in place.
